轻松指南:如何备份数据库文档
备份数据库文档怎么弄

首页 2025-04-12 01:47:28



备份数据库文档:确保数据安全与业务连续性的关键步骤 在当今数字化时代,数据已成为企业最宝贵的资产之一

    无论是金融交易记录、客户信息、业务运营数据,还是创新研发资料,数据库都是这些核心信息的存储中心

    然而,面对自然灾害、人为错误、恶意攻击等潜在威胁,数据丢失或损坏的风险始终存在

    因此,制定并实施一套高效、可靠的数据库备份策略,对于维护数据安全、保障业务连续性至关重要

    本文将详细介绍如何系统地规划和执行数据库备份文档,以确保您的企业数据在任何情况下都能得到快速恢复

     一、认识数据库备份的重要性 1.数据保护:定期备份可以有效防止数据因硬件故障、软件漏洞或人为失误而丢失

     2.业务连续性:在遭遇灾难性事件时,快速恢复数据意味着业务中断时间最短,减少经济损失

     3.合规性:许多行业法规要求企业保留特定时间段内的数据记录,备份是满足这些合规要求的基础

     4.测试与开发:备份数据还可用于测试环境搭建、数据分析及历史数据回溯,支持业务决策与优化

     二、备份前的准备工作 1.评估需求:明确备份的频率(如每日、每周)、保留周期(如30天、90天)、恢复时间目标(RTO)和恢复点目标(RPO)

     2.选择备份类型: -全量备份:复制整个数据库的所有数据,适合作为基础备份

     -增量备份:仅备份自上次备份以来发生变化的数据部分,减少存储空间和备份时间

     -差异备份:备份自上次全量备份以来所有变化的数据,介于全量和增量之间

     3.确定备份位置:本地存储、远程服务器、云存储或磁带库,考虑成本、安全性及访问速度

     4.备份工具选择:根据数据库类型(如MySQL、Oracle、SQL Server等)选择合适的备份软件或内置工具

     5.权限与策略制定:确保备份操作由授权人员执行,制定详细的备份计划和应急预案

     三、实施数据库备份步骤 1.配置备份软件: - 安装并配置备份软件,设置备份任务的时间表、类型、目标位置等参数

     - 对于大型数据库,考虑使用压缩和加密功能以节省空间并确保数据安全

     2.执行首次全量备份: - 在实施任何增量或差异备份之前,先进行全量备份,作为数据恢复的基线

     - 验证备份文件的完整性和可读性,确保备份成功

     3.自动化备份流程: - 利用任务调度器(如cron作业、Windows任务计划程序)自动执行备份任务,减少人为干预

     - 设置监控和报警机制,当备份失败时及时通知管理员

     4.日志备份: - 对于支持事务的数据库,定期备份事务日志,以支持时间点恢复

     - 确保日志备份与全量/增量备份协调一致,避免数据丢失

     5.测试备份恢复: - 定期进行备份恢复演练,验证备份的有效性和恢复流程的效率

     - 记录恢复过程中遇到的问题及解决方案,持续优化备份策略

     四、备份文档的编制与管理 1.备份策略文档: - 详细描述备份类型、频率、保留周期、存储位置、备份工具及配置参数

     - 包括备份操作的具体步骤、责任分配、监控与报警机制

     2.恢复指南: - 编制详尽的恢复流程文档,涵盖不同场景下的恢复步骤、所需资源、预期恢复时间等

     - 确保所有关键岗位人员熟悉恢复流程,必要时进行培训

     3.版本管理: - 对备份策略和恢复指南进行版本控制,每次修改后更新版本号、修改日期及变更说明

     - 保留旧版本以备不时之需,特别是在升级备份工具或调整策略时

     4.审计与合规: - 记录每次备份和恢复操作的日志,包括执行时间、操作人、结果等,以备审计

     - 确保备份策略符合行业法规和企业内部政策要求

     五、最佳实践与注意事项 1.多地点存储:采用异地备份策略,将备份数据存储在物理上分离的位置,以防区域性灾难

     2.定期审计:定期审查备份数据的完整性和可用性,及时发现并解决潜在问题

     3.数据加密:对备份数据进行加密处理,防止数据在传输和存储过程中被非法访问

     4.资源优化:合理分配备份任务的时间窗口,避免与业务高峰期冲突,减少系统负载

     5.持续学习与更新:跟踪最新的备份技术和最佳实践,定期评估并更新备份策略以适应业务发展和技术变革

     六、结语 数据库备份不仅仅是技术操作,更是企业数据安全管理的重要组成部分

    通过科学合理的备份策略、严谨的操作流程、完善的文档管理和持续的优化改进,企业能够有效防范数据丢失风险,确保业务在任何情况下都能迅速恢复运行

    记住,备份不是一次性的任务,而是需要长期坚持并持续改进的过程

    在这个数字化时代,让数据成为推动企业发展的强大动力,而非制约其发展的瓶颈

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道